Armor Types in Counter-Strike 2

A protective kit consisting of a vest is available for $650, while a kit with a helmet costs $1,000. If the vest is intact, the helmet can be purchased separately for $350 at the start of a new round. If the vest is damaged, it must be repurchased at its original price.

The functionality of the Vest plus Helmet set remains unchanged regardless of the armor wear level, which can vary from 30 to 100. The armor’s damage absorption efficiency remains stable throughout its use.

How does armor work in CS2?

The armor mechanism in Counter-Strike 2 is different from most multiplayer shooters: it does not act as an invisible barrier. Instead, armor only reduces a certain amount of damage, the amount of which depends on the type of weapon used by the enemy. With each absorbed hit, the armor’s level of protection decreases, and when it drops to zero, the armor disappears completely.

Armor protects not only from gunshots, but also from various other dangers, including explosives and melee weapons. Interestingly, armor effectively reduces damage even from direct hits from grenades or C4 explosions!

What does armor not protect against?

Armor in Counter-Strike 2 does not provide protection against certain types of threats. For example, it is completely ineffective against damage from shots from the SG 553 rifle and hits from incendiary grenades, which guarantee maximum damage. In addition, wearing armor does not affect movement speed, jump distance, weapon recoil, or the character’s visual appearance.

More about the benefits of armor

One of the key benefits of wearing armor in Counter-Strike 2 is not so much reducing damage taken, but minimizing the recoil effect when taking a hit from an enemy. This effect is greatly reduced by armor, and with a helmet it is almost eliminated, allowing for a more stable aim.

You may have noticed the serious screen shake when taking a hit from an enemy without wearing a vest. This is the effect.

Helmets play a key role in protecting the player’s head from gunfire. Of all the weapons in the game, only twelve models can kill a player with a single headshot while wearing a helmet, and only eight of them can do so from several meters away.

Selecting a reservation and when

Now we get to the fun part of this article. When can you skimp on armor and when should you buy both a helmet and a vest? Start with the principle that you should buy some kind of armor in every round you play. The exceptions are pure economy or semi-economy rounds, where you might want to buy a Desert Eagle but can’t afford armor. You can also skip armor in pistol rounds. Why?

In pistol rounds, you can only buy a vest, but there’s a high chance of being sent to the lobby with a headshot from a Glock-18 or USP-S. So you can save $650 for grenades or a better pistol. Ultimately, the decision is yours, but keep this in mind in your competitive matches.

When to skimp and only buy a vest? This is easy when you’re playing on defense and you’re confident your opponent has a full buy. This means they’re playing with an AK-47, which can kill you with one headshot regardless of whether you have a helmet. So why spend the extra $350?

On the other hand, on the offensive side, it’s generally better to always buy the full armor for $1000. It protects you from being killed by the first bullet from an M4A1S/M4A4 or a random bullet from a USP-S. Especially when you know your opponents have farm guns or something similar.

Of course, when you have a lot of money, don’t skimp on armor and buy both a helmet and a vest. It will never hurt you, and you won’t even feel it on you. It’s not like carrying 10 kilograms of potatoes.

When to buy armor again?

An important question that players may be wondering is whether it is necessary to replenish armor at the beginning of the round. When you have 80% wear on your vest, you can buy a helmet for $350 or restore armor for $650. But is it necessary?

If your regular vest is at least 75% worn out, there is no need to renew your armor. Obviously, if it is lower, upgrade it without a second thought. And of course, always buy a helmet if you can.
